Thunder vs. Grizzlies final score: Gasol plays hero in 90-89 OT thriller

Marc Gasol went into hero mode and lifted the Grizzlies past a major Western Conference foe.

Marc Gasol's tip-in as time expired gave the Memphis Grizzlies a 90-89 home win against the Oklahoma City Thunder in overtime at FedExForum on Wednesday night.

Jerryd Bayless made a three-pointer with three seconds remaining in regulation to send the game into the extra frame, where the Grizzlies finished off the defending Western Conference champions at home.

Mike Conley led the way for the Memphis (46-21) with 24 points on 9-of-21 shooting from the field and added seven assists and five rebounds. Gasol, who played hero, collected a double-double with 14 points and 15 rebounds. Memphis didn't shoot well as a team at just a 36 percent clip, but overcame it by outrebounding the Thunder by a margin of 54-46.

Kevin Durant had a game-high with 32 points and grabbed eight rebounds to lead the Thunder (50-19). Russell Wetbrook added 20 points, four rebounds and three assists with four steals on the defensive end as the OKC couldn't overcome the Grizzlies' stout defense that held them to just 35.7 percent from the field.

The back-and-fourth, defensive battle between the two conference powerhouses featured 14 lead changes and four ties.
